Available Services

The following is a brief list of services offered at the Embassy of France in Valletta, Malta:

  • Process passport applications
  • Process visa applications
  • Notarize certain documents
  • Legalization of documents
  • Issuing emergency travel documents
  • Register marriages, births, and deaths

Visa Requirements

If you hold a Maltese passport, you do not need a visa to enter France.

Note: Visa requirements are determined by your nationality and the reason for your visit. Exceptions may arise based on the length of stay, specific conditions, or travel purpose.
